
例如: void faulty_producer(std::promise<double>&& prms) { try { throw std::runtime_error("计算失败"); } catch (...) { prms.set_exception(std::...

这时候,循环遍历(for循环)就成了你的好帮手。 在使用yii框架的`activetextarea`组件时,直接在属性参数中拼接字符串会导致“property not defined”错误。 内存消耗: 如果queryset或external_data_list非常庞大,考虑分批处理数据,避免一次性...

现代框架基于JavaScript/TypeScript、HTML和CSS,是Web技术栈。 Go在将其映射为[N]byte时,会确保分配足够的空间,但如果您在Go侧手动构建复杂的C结构体或union,需要额外注意对齐问题,以避免潜在的性能问题或崩溃。 语义复杂性: 接口定义 giveHug(Anim...

它们共同建立了一个单向的“happens-before”关系,是实现生产者-消费者模型等同步模式的基石。 我们将分析初学者常犯的错误——替换逻辑未累积,并提供一个优化的解决方案,确保所有指定词语都能在句子中被正确替换。 array_diff_key():基于键名进行比较,返回在第一个数组中有而其他数...

Golang中可借助golang.org/x/time/rate包快速实现基于令牌桶的限流。 本教程将深入解析这一包名遮蔽问题,指导开发者如何识别、解决此类冲突,并提供预防措施,确保time包及其类型能被正确引用和使用。 然而,Loguru 默认情况下并不会自动捕获这些通过 `sys.excepth...

该方法系统高效,是Go测试实践核心。 同时,本文还强调了登录验证中的安全最佳实践,以防止恶意攻击。 无论是服务器本地缓存,还是CDN(内容分发网络),都能有效减少重复处理的开销。 错误处理:如果str.extract未能匹配到任何内容,它将返回NaN。 使用template关键字声明模板参数。 请务...

不能调用非const成员函数:即使函数内部没有修改操作,也不能调用普通成员函数。 在C++中,重载输入输出运算符(<< 和 >>)可以让自定义类的对象像内置类型一样使用 cout 和 cin。 保持一致性: 在整个项目中坚持使用相同的缩进风格。 strtotime()对日期格...

AppMall应用商店 AI应用商店,提供即时交付、按需付费的人工智能应用服务 56 查看详情 在 overlays/prod 中添加自定义配置:# configmap.yaml apiVersion: v1 kind: ConfigMap metadata: name: dotnet-app-co...

解决方案 要使用Composer管理项目依赖,我们首先得把它请进门,也就是安装它。 1. 使用 isset() 函数 isset() 函数可以用来检查变量是否已设置并且非 NULL。 建议加入版本控制字段,便于未来扩展。 mPDF的页面分页机制概述 mPDF是一个强大的PHP库,用于将HTML和CS...

本教程详细讲解如何在Pandas DataFrame中,精准地填充位于特定“起始”和“结束”字符串之间的NaN值,同时保留其他位置的NaN。 它能帮助你构建一个清晰的程序集加载图谱。 Go语言中的Map(哈希表)是无序的数据结构,其迭代顺序不被语言规范保证,并且可能在每次迭代、不同程序运行甚至不同G...